Originally Posted by seabiscuit
Ok. I have looked all the posts and it looks that Eibach Pro Kit makes the cars the most lower from all others.
Two questions:
1/ Are you changing only springs or dampeners as well plus sway bars with Eibach Pro Kit?
2/ What else have to be changed (or is recommended to be changed) in suspension / steering when you lower the car?
If you just go for the springs, they will destroy your struts and shocks after some 20K miles. It happened to me. Well I was aware of it and now changed to Steeda's Coil over suspension system by Tokico. It's great and you can lower or highten your car as much as you want. This goes way below any Eibachs or any other spring set. If you want to save some bucks, go for a spring set first. If you want to do it right from day 1, go for the Steeda coil over system.
